Learn about the history of HUDSON VALLEY BRIDGES AND THEIR BENEFITS THROUGH A SLIDE SHOW PRESENTATION, iPads, and panels with Jacqueline Sparacino from HISTORIC BRIDGES OF THE HUDSON VALLEY. We will discover the best way to and will BUILD OUR OWN BRIDGE. Some materials will be provided but please bring some materials of your own: straws, toilet paper rolls, cardboard, string, popsicle sticks, etc.This is geared to children aged 4 - 10. Jacqueline Sparacino holds two NYS teacher certifications in Early Childhood Education and English 7-12, a Bachelor’s degree from SUNY Cortland and a Master’s from Union Graduate College.
